Compare Rock Island to Elgin
This post compares Rock Island, Illinois to Elgin, Illinois across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Rock Island (city) | Elgin (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 38,560 | 112,628 |
Income (median) | $41,366 | $41,941 |
Home Value (median) | $100,500 | $171,200 |
White | 69% | 61% |
Black | 20% | 6% |
Asian | 3% | 6% |
With Kids | 28% | 41% |
Age (median) | 37 | 34 |
Rentals | 34% | 33% |
